Diagnostic value of shear wave elastography combined with carbohydrate antigen 15-3 for benign and malignant BI-RADS category 4 breast masses

Abstract:
Objective To explore the value of shear wave elastography(SWE)combined with carbohydrate antigen 15-3(CA15-3)in differentiating benign and malignant breast imaging and reporting data system(BI-RADS)category 4 breast masses.Methods Ninety patients with breast tumors confirmed by surgical pathology at the Affiliated Hospital of Yunnan University from December 2021 to June 2024 were enrolled,all with BI-RADS category 4 breast masses.The patients were divided into a benign group(n=42)and a malignant group(n=48)according to whether the breast masses were benign or malignant.All of them underwent SWE examination,and serum CA15-3 levels were determined using electrochemiluminescence method.Serum CA15-3 levels and SWE parameters[elasticity standard deviation(ESD),mean elasticity value(Emean),maximum elasticity value(Emax)and the ratio of breast mass elasticity to same-layer low fat elasticity(Eratio)]were compared between the two groups.The area under the receiver operating characteristic curve(AUC)was used to evaluate the diagnostic performance of serum CA15-3 levels,SWE parameters,and their combination for benign and malignant BI-RADS category 4 breast masses.Results The SWE parameters(ESD,Emean,Emax,and Eratio)and serum CA15-3 levels in the malignant group were significantly higher than those in the benign group(P<0.05).The AUC values of ESD,Emean,Emax,Eratio,and serum CA15-3 levels for the diagnosis of benign and malignant BI-RADS category 4 breast masses were 0.718(95%CI:0.613-0.824),0.791(95%CI:0.701-0.881),0.721(95%CI:0.615-0.826),0.721(95%CI:0.613-0.830)and 0.793(95%CI:0.702-0.885),respectively.Notably,SWE parameters combined with serum CA15-3 levels achieved an AUC value of 0.953(95%CI:0.917-0.992).Conclusion The combination of CA15-3 and SWE exhibits high efficiency in diagnosing the benign and malignant nature of BI-RADS category 4 breast masses.
